effects of extremely-slender prepreg layers on reducing delamination in composite sections

Delamination is a common failure method in layered composites, generally threatening the structural integrity of aerospace and automotive components. a few of the most effective approaches to combat delamination include using extremely-slender prepreg layers, which maximize the quantity of interfaces from the laminate and improve interlaminar toughness. Carbon fiber prepreg suppliers that focus on skinny-ply goods present layers as slim as 0.03 to 0.19 millimeters, allowing companies to make up laminates with increased ply counts and finer Manage around resin distribution. This good layering enhances load transfer between plies and cuts down microcrack formation, efficiently reducing the risk of delamination over time. Carbon fiber prepreg suppliers who supply these extremely-skinny prepregs enable producers to improve composite layup processes and develop parts with Increased fatigue resistance.
